OPERATION INSTRUCTIONS
Read the drying directions for the type of paint being used. Multiple layers of 1.
paint may effect proper drying time.
The object to be dried should be placed between 12” and 20” from the Lamp. 2.
Refer to instructions for the paint being used.
Clear area of all potentially flammable items, including those that may melt or be 3.
damaged by heat. Never use near fuel, fuel lines, or oil of any sort.
To adjust the height of the Lamp, turn the knob on the Connector (6) 4.
counterclockwise and slide the Lamp Head (9) up or down along the Top Pole (5)
until the desired height is reached. Turn the knob on the Connector (6) clockwise
until the Connector is secured in place.
To Adjust the angle of the Lamp Head (9), turn the Wing Nut (8) counterclockwise 5.
until the Connector Bolt (7) loosens, allowing the angle of the Lamp Head (9) to
be adjusted. Once the desired angle is found, turn the Wing Nut (8) clockwise to
secure the Lamp Head (9) in place.
Plug the Lamp into a 3-prong outlet, and turn Power Switch on the Lamp Head 6.
(9) to the “ON” position.
Make sure the Lamp is on a flat, level surface to prevent rolling. When moving 7.
the Lamp, slowly guide the Lamp along the floor by pulling on the center of the
Bottom Pole (1) to avoid danger of tipping.
Monitor Lamp and adjust as necessary to ensure quality finish. 8.
Allow the Lamp to cool before moving and do not touch the Lamp bulb with bare 9.
fingers.
Caution: Keep fingers and all objects clear of Lamp at all times. When
in use, and immediately afterwards, the bulb will be hot and could cause
injury if touched.
INSPECTION, MAINTENANCE, AND CLEANING
1. WARNING! Make sure the Power Switch of the Lamp is in its “OFF” position,
that the tool is unplugged from its electrical outlet, and that the unit is allowed
to cool completely before performing any inspection, maintenance, or cleaning
procedures.
BEFORE EACH USE,2. inspect the general condition of the Lamp. Check for loose
screws, misalignment or binding of moving parts, cracked or broken parts, damaged
electrical wiring, and any other condition that may affect its safe operation. If
abnormal noise or vibration occurs, have the problem corrected before further use.
Do not use damaged equipment.
